疲勞損傷的在線跟蹤監(jiān)測
(福州大學(xué) 中心實(shí)驗(yàn)室,福州 350002)
摘 要: 用系統(tǒng)分析的方法,在線跟蹤觀察了40Cr鋼Ni-P化學(xué)鍍層及化學(xué)鍍層經(jīng)晶化處理后的試樣疲勞損傷過程。實(shí)驗(yàn)結(jié)果表明:系統(tǒng)分析的方法能夠敏感地跟蹤疲勞損傷過程;金屬材料表面Ni-P化學(xué)鍍層狀態(tài),影響材料疲勞損傷的過程和形式,使材料的疲勞壽命下降50%以上。
關(guān)鍵字: Ni-P化學(xué)鍍;系統(tǒng)分析;疲勞損傷

Abstract:A calculation model of fatigue damage is proposed using system analysis method. Three-point-bending fatigue test was applied to investigate fatigue damage parameter of electroless Ni-P coated 40Cr steel. The result reveals that the system analysis method is effective, the fatigue strength of the plated steel decreases by 50% and more.
Key words: system analysis; electroless Ni-P coating; fatigue damage
